OBITUARY: David McCullough, Chief Executive Officer, The Abbeyfield Society Care home groups | David McCullough | Leaders | Operators | People | The Abbeyfield Society The Abbeyfield Society has announced that Chief Executive Officer, David McCullough, sadly passed away suddenly on Monday 8 February 2021…. February 23, 2021 Read more